Are you brave enough to run 10k blindfolded?


News provided by The Royal London Society for Blind People on Thursday 12th Jun 2014



RLSB, London’s leading charity for blind young people, launched the UK’s first Blindfold Run challenge today at the Queen Elizabeth Olympic Park which has been supported by Silent Witness star, Emilia Fox. 

This unique event works with runners working in pairs. One person is blindfolded and tethered to a sighted runner, who narrates the twists and turns of the track to make it round the 5k or10k course. The event will be held at the Queen Elizabeth Olympic Park on 2nd November 2014.

RLSB’s Chief Executive Dr. Tom Pey said;

“If you ask a totally blind person what they see they will tell you that they see nothing. This concept of nothingness is difficult to grasp if never experienced. Our Blindfold Run is designed to bring you to understand it. And it’s a great chance to make a special bond with your sighted guide. Literally, your safety is in their hands and you have to trust them implicitly. All of this and you are raising money for vision impaired young people – so that they can live a life without limits.
